From 6da7a2afdc7fce7c6387cc8fc05d3548132e8ee3 Mon Sep 17 00:00:00 2001 From: Xavier Noguer Gallego Date: Wed, 23 Apr 2003 23:25:49 +0000 Subject: [PATCH] fixing swapping of columns in formulas (JT Hughes) git-svn-id: https://svn.php.net/repository/pear/packages/Spreadsheet_Excel_Writer/trunk@124415 c90b9560-bf6c-de11-be94-00142212c4b1 --- Writer/Parser.php |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/Writer/Parser.php b/Writer/Parser.php index 8825b2c..865bdb4 100644 --- a/Writer/Parser.php +++ b/Writer/Parser.php @@ -938,12 +938,12 @@ class Spreadsheet_Excel_Writer_Parser extends PEAR $row = $match[4]; // Convert base26 column string to a number. - $expn = 0; + $expn = strlen($col_ref) - 1; $col = 0; for($i=0; $i < strlen($col_ref); $i++) { $col += (ord($col_ref{$i}) - ord('A') + 1) * pow(26, $expn); - $expn++; + $expn--; } // Convert 1-index to zero-index